Furka and Grimsel Pass Questions
During my ED in July, one of my driving legs is from Varenna, Italy (Lake Como) to Lucerne, Switzerland, which I have budgeted a full day to drive in my M3. As part of the drive, I will take the St. Gotthard > Furka > Grimsel Passes to get to Lucerne.
Has anyone visited the Rhone Glacier/Ice Grotto next to Hotel Belvedere or the Gelmer Funicular (world's steepest) along this drive? I am looking for thing to see and do along this drive other than the beautiful scenery and am wondering if either one of these attractions is worth stopping off and experiencing? Also, is there a trick to the drive transition to get from the St. Gotthard to the Furka Pass? I try to map it on Google Maps and the transitions seem to drive past the intersection then backtracks onto the Furka Pass. Rhone Glacier and Ice Grotto (Entrance at Hotel Belvedere) Gästecenter Obergoms, Im Kehr 3985 Münster Web: http://www.wanderland.ch/en/services...keit-0210.html Gelmer Funicular Railway (Gelmerbahn) Grimselstrasse 19 3862 – Innertkirchen, Switzerland Admission: 32 CHF Tickets: Available at the Grimseltor Tourist Centre in Innertkirchen and at the bottom stations of the Gelmer Funicular. Hours: Daily, 9am-5m Web: http://www.grimselwelt.ch/grimsel-ex...mer-funicular/ |
